Q: Is 131,110,344 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 131,110,344 is a composite number.

Why is 131,110,344 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 131,110,344 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 36 72 1,820,977 3,641,954 5,462,931 7,283,908 10,925,862 14,567,816 16,388,793 21,851,724 32,777,586 43,703,448 65,555,172 and 131,110,344, with no remainder.

Since 131,110,344 cannot be divided by just 1 and 131,110,344, it is a composite number.
